Types of Honeywell Air Temperature Sensors
Honeywell offers a range of air temperature sensors, each suited for specific applications. Here are the primary types:
- Digital Temperature Sensors: These sensors provide precise temperature readings and can easily integrate with digital displays or control systems.
- Thermocouple Sensors: Known for their wide temperature range and durability, thermocouple sensors are ideal for extreme environments.
- RTD Sensors (Resistance Temperature Detectors): These sensors offer exceptional accuracy and stability, making them perfect for applications that require high precision.
- Infrared Sensors: These non-contact sensors measure temperature from a distance, ideal for moving objects or hazardous materials.

Applications of Honeywell Air Temperature Sensor
The versatility of the Honeywell Air Temperature Sensor makes it suitable for a wide array of applications, including:
- HVAC Systems: These sensors are integral in monitoring and controlling heating, ventilation, and air conditioning systems to ensure efficient energy use and comfort.
- Industrial Processes: In manufacturing, accurate temperature tracking is essential for maintaining product quality and safety during production.
- Weather Stations: Honeywell sensors can be deployed in meteorological setups for precise climate monitoring.
- Food Preservation: Ensuring that food storage environments maintain the right temperature is crucial, making these sensors key in refrigerators and freezers.
- Agricultural Applications: With temperature monitoring, farmers can optimize conditions for crop growth, enhancing yield and quality.
